Why a Professional Dog Paw Trimmer Is Necessary
I’ve learned that keeping my dog’s paws properly trimmed is not just about appearance—it’s about comfort, safety, and overall health. When the fur around my dog’s paws gets too long, it can trap dirt, mud, and even small debris, which makes walking uncomfortable. A professional dog paw trimmer helps me keep that area neat and clean, so my dog can move around more easily and stay happier.
I also use a professional trimmer because it gives me better control and a safer cut. My dog’s paws are sensitive, and I don’t want to risk pulling hair or accidentally nicking the skin with the wrong tool. A good trimmer is designed to handle delicate areas, which gives me peace of mind and helps make grooming a smoother experience for both of us.
Another reason I find it necessary is hygiene. Long paw hair can hold moisture, and that can lead to irritation or even infections if I don’t stay on top of grooming. By trimming regularly, I help reduce the chance of mats, odor, and skin problems. For me, a professional dog paw trimmer is an important part of responsible pet care.

What I Look for in a Good Paw Trimmer
For me, the best paw trimmer has to be gentle on sensitive areas. I always look for a trimmer with a quiet motor, sharp blades, and a design that gives me better control. Since paw trimming requires accuracy, I prefer a lightweight tool that fits comfortably in my hand and doesn’t vibrate too much.
Blade Quality Matters to Me
I pay close attention to the blade material because it affects both performance and safety. Stainless steel or ceramic blades usually work best for me because they stay sharp longer and reduce pulling. I also like blades that are easy to clean, since hygiene is very important when grooming my dog regularly.
Noise and Vibration Are Important
My dog gets nervous with loud grooming tools, so I always choose a trimmer that runs quietly. Low vibration is just as important because it helps me keep my dog calm and still. A quieter trimmer makes the whole process easier for both of us.
Safety Features I Prefer
Since I’m trimming around sensitive paw areas, I want a trimmer with rounded edges or a safety guard. I also look for models that don’t overheat quickly, because a hot blade can make my dog uncomfortable. Safety features give me more confidence while grooming at home.
Battery Life and Power Options
I prefer a cordless trimmer because it gives me more freedom to move around my dog. Long battery life is a big plus for me, especially if I need to trim more than one area. If I choose a corded model, I make sure the cord is long enough and easy to manage.
Ease of Cleaning and Maintenance
I always choose a trimmer that is easy to clean after use. Detachable blades or washable parts save me time and help me maintain the tool properly. Regular cleaning also keeps the trimmer working well and helps prevent skin irritation for my dog.
Comfort and Grip
A comfortable grip makes a huge difference for me during grooming sessions. If the trimmer feels awkward or heavy, it becomes harder to control. I like ergonomic designs because they help me trim more steadily and reduce hand fatigue.
